Output 6807c75c38a2f6348ee4f9e5e7e535f491df07ef243f9b8735063a18af34a0ae:1

value
12047292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870cabf6dbb340b86d68f394f4c421d77cf90f9c OP_EQUAL
address
3E16KtV6XkNrEwrPJvK2KThmuWVKY7Hbj4
transaction
6807c75c38a2f6348ee4f9e5e7e535f491df07ef243f9b8735063a18af34a0ae
spent
true